FARMINGTON — Student of the Month Awards for Mt. Blue High School’s second quarter were given to freshman Michelle Seaburg, freshman Lorna Ayer, senior Makenzie Seaward and senior James Anderson.
Future Business Leaders of America (FBLA) sponsors the Student of the Month Assembly. Students are selected by faculty based on individual characteristics of academic performance, community and school activities, character, attendance, and overall outstanding citizenship.
This quarter’s recipients received gift bags prepared by FBLA containing multiple gift certificates from local businesses such as Dunkin’ Donuts, and Subway. They also received a gift certificate to the Coffee Shop on campus, movie passes, Sweet Life Kettle Corn, and chocolates for Valentine’s Day. FBLA would like to thank the following businesses for their generous donations: Farmington Subway, Dunkin’ Donuts, Ms. Minear in the Coffee Shop on Campus, and Sweet Life Kettle Corn.
Senior recipients will also enjoy the parking spaces reserved for the Student of The Month for an entire quarter, located in the teacher parking lot at the front of the school.
